About the Role

We are hiring a Client Support Associate to support a fast-growing U.S.-based cybersecurity and managed security services company. The role sits within Client Services & Operations and focuses on delivering a seamless client experience while supporting day-to-day client operations, onboarding, account coordination, and internal processes.

This is a full-time opportunity for someone who is highly organized, proactive, detail-oriented, and comfortable managing multiple priorities across clients, vendors, and internal teams.

The ideal candidate is a strong communicator who can simplify complex processes, take ownership of tasks, and work effectively in a fast-paced, entrepreneurial environment.

What You'll Be Doing

Client Management

  • Serve as a primary point of contact for clients and help ensure a positive client experience.
  • Respond to client inquiries and manage expectations through phone, email, and other communication channels.
  • Build and maintain strong client relationships.
  • Maintain accurate client files and documentation.
  • Support renewals and process sales orders.
  • Monitor and manage customer support emails and Freshservice tickets.
  • Document client communications, activities, and follow-ups.

Client Onboarding & Operations

  • Coordinate new client onboarding activities with customers and vendors.
  • Create and prepare sales and onboarding documentation.
  • Coordinate the transition from sales through onboarding.
  • Support client communications throughout the onboarding process.
  • Assist with event planning and management.
  • Identify opportunities to improve internal processes and operational efficiency.

Account Management & Administrative Support

  • Maintain accurate client databases, including recording account additions, changes, and removals.
  • Assist with monthly financial and billing records.
  • Reconcile billing information across Monday.com, vendor billing spreadsheets, and QuickBooks.
  • Maintain accurate records of account activity and ensure CRM information is up to date.
  • Support multiple team members with administrative and operational tasks.
